Hey, future maintainers: Feedwright checks podcast feeds for malformed enclosures, bad durations, and the weird duplicate-GUID thing that keeps biting the Oakhaven shows. The validation rules live in a single config pack; don't split it, I tried and regretted it. Nightly runs email a digest; failures over 5% page whoever's on rotation. One gotcha: the cached feed store is encrypted at rest and the service account can't auto-unlock it after a cold restart. In that case, unseal it manually with the recovery passphrase below.

vault phrase of bagap-yajof = fenath-druwyn

## Handover: password reset revamp (Keyline service)

The revamped reset flow shipped Thursday. Tokens are now single-use, expire after 20 minutes, and are bound to the requesting device fingerprint. Legacy tokens were invalidated at cut-over, so expect a small bump in "link expired" tickets through the weekend. Rollback is a feature flag flip, no deploy needed. If you get paged, first confirm the service is running with the expected settings, shown below.

config for baweg-kaweg:
[tameth]
port = 8443
team = julix
host = tameth.olvarqio.internal
region = central-2
access_code = ac_c8adbe
timeout_ms = 2000

Q: What do I do if the Lanternby CSV import wizard rejects an entire file? A: Check the delimiter sniffing first — it guesses from the first 50 rows and gets tripped up by quoted commas. You can force a delimiter in the advanced pane. Partial imports roll back automatically, so nothing lands half-written. If the wizard's own config store gets corrupted (rare, but it happens after failed upgrades), you'll need admin recovery access, which is unlocked with the passphrase directly below this entry.

vault phrase of tajop-haduf = holath-brivan-wenax

## Authentication

Heads up, reviewer: the Fennelwick schema registry won't accept anonymous reads anymore. Every client — even the CI linter — sends a bearer key in the `X-Fenn-Key` header when fetching or publishing event schemas. Local dev uses the shared staging credential, which we keep out of the repo. The current staging key is below.

gateway credential: kto3_qfe